SOON-TO-BE KUYA

Taking their first step in service, Sir Rolly Casera and Sir Jenesis Mapa successfully carried out their initial Community Service activity—one of the standard requirements before becoming full-fledged Eagles. This milestone marks the fulfillment of one out of the three required Community Service (CS) activities, reflecting their growing commitment to service, brotherhood, and leadership.

In The Fraternal Order of Eagles (TFOE), aspiring members undergo a structured journey known as the 5 I’s: Interview, Introduction, Inception, Incubation, and Induction. Beyond these formation stages, applicants are expected to actively live out the core values of the Order by completing three Community Service activities and attending three regular club meetings.

Each step is not merely a requirement, but a preparation—shaping future Kuya who is ready to serve with integrity, compassion, and a genuine heart for the community.

GSEC HOLDS YEAR-END GENERAL MONTHLY MEETING, STRENGTHENS FRATERNAL BROTHERHOOD AND LEADERSHIP

The Golden Surigao Eagles Club (GSEC) successfully held its year-end General Monthly Meeting (GMM) on December 30, 2025, in Karihatag, Malimono, Surigao del Norte. The activity gathered all Kuya Members of the club and served as a significant occasion to celebrate brotherhood, leadership transition, and organizational growth within the Fraternal Order of Eagles (Philippine Eagles).

The meeting was hosted and sponsored by the newly inducted Kuya Members—Kuya Ali, Kuya Norman, Kuya Reynaldo, Kuya Bermar Angelo, and Kuya Marciano—reflecting their commitment to shared responsibility and active participation in fraternal service.

Honoring the event were esteemed Kuya and Ate delegates from the Budjong Butuan Eagles Club (BBEC), under the Butuan Eagles District of the Northeastern Mindanao Eagles Region (CARAGA). The delegation was led by Eagle Jerry De Guzman, District Governor, and Eagle Teodoro “Ted” Montes, Regional Governor, whose presence reinforced regional unity and strengthened inter-club camaraderie.

One of the highlights of the GMM was the oathtaking of the newly elected GSEC Officers for Eagle Year 2026, officially ushering in a new leadership cycle under the presidency of Eagle Septeriano Senoc Jr., GSEC Club President for Eagle Year 2026. The ceremony affirmed the club’s readiness to pursue its goals anchored on service, discipline, and brotherhood.

The gathering also witnessed the oathtaking of Kuya Eulogio Ferol III as the new Vice Governor of the Butuan Eagles District, marking a notable milestone for both the district and the GSEC, as it continues to produce leaders entrusted with higher responsibilities within the Order.

Another significant feature of the meeting was the conduct of interview and formal introduction of three (3) new applicants, facilitated by Eagle Allan Joville, BBEC Club President for Eagle Year 2026 and Chairman of the Regional Club Membership Committee. This process ensured adherence to the standards and values of the Fraternal Order, underscoring the importance of integrity and readiness in welcoming new members.

The Fraternal Order of Eagles (Philippine Eagles) is a socio-civic organization founded on the core principles of Service, Unity, and Brotherhood, committed to nation-building through humanitarian initiatives, leadership development, and community engagement. Activities such as the GMM serve as vital platforms for strengthening bonds, sustaining organizational discipline, and advancing the mission of the Order.

The year-end GMM of the Golden Surigao Eagles Club stood not only as a culmination of Eagle Year 2025 but also as a strong declaration of unity and purpose as the club moves forward into Eagle Year 2026, steadfast in its commitment to fraternal service and excellence.

𝐆𝐎𝐋𝐃𝐄𝐍 𝐒𝐔𝐑𝐈𝐆𝐀𝐎 𝐄𝐀𝐆𝐋𝐄𝐒 𝐂𝐋𝐔𝐁 𝐃𝐎𝐍𝐀𝐓𝐄𝐒 𝐁𝐀𝐑𝐑𝐈𝐂𝐀𝐃𝐄 𝐓𝐎 𝐒𝐈𝐒𝐎𝐍 𝐄𝐋𝐄𝐌𝐄𝐍𝐓𝐀𝐑𝐘 𝐒𝐂𝐇𝐎𝐎𝐋

𝑺𝒊𝒔𝒐𝒏, 𝑺𝒖𝒓𝒊𝒈𝒂𝒐 𝒅𝒆𝒍 𝑵𝒐𝒓𝒕𝒆 — With its enduring commitment to nation-building and community service, the Golden Surigao 𝓔𝓪𝓰𝓵𝓮𝓼 Club (GSEC) reached another milestone in its mission of service through the donation of a new school barricade to Sison Elementary School SPED Center, in partnership with the school officials and stakeholders.

The donation ceremony was held on August 8, 2025, in the presence of the GSEC members, school faculty, PTA representatives, and learners. The event was a testament to the Club’s advocacy of strengthening educational institutions by providing safer and more conducive learning environments.

Sison Elementary School Principal IV, Mrs. Mercedita Albiño, warmly welcomed the GSEC members and expressed her gratitude: “Dako kaayo among pasalamat sa inyong grupo. Ang barricade nga inyong gihatag dili lamang pisikal nga proteksyon, kundi simbolo sa inyong pagtagad sa edukasyon ug kaluwasan sa among mga estudyante. Kini usa ka dakong tabang alang sa among eskwelahan ug komunidad.”

The purpose of the activity was succinctly captured by GSEC Secretary, 𝓔𝓪𝓰𝓵𝓮 Septeriano B. Senoc Jr., in his statement of purpose: “GSEC stands for Giving back to the Community, Securing the future of learners, Empowering the school as hub of learning, and Commitment to service and excellence. This initiative is part of our continuous efforts to support educational institutions and promote safe learning spaces. We believe that simple gestures like this can create ripples of impact in the lives of our young learners.”

GSEC Club President, 𝓔𝓪𝓰𝓵𝓮 John Jestoni Besas, emphasized the club’s vision and the importance of community collaboration: "This is more than just a donation—it is a shared responsibility. As members of the Golden Surigao 𝓔𝓪𝓰𝓵𝓮𝓼 Club, we commit ourselves to meaningful service. We hope that this barricade serves as a reminder that there are people and organizations ready to support the dreams of the youth."

The activity concluded with a short fellowship and photo opportunity, marking yet another meaningful contribution of GSEC to the academic communities of Surigao del Norte. #

𝐆𝐒𝐄𝐂 𝐇𝐎𝐋𝐃𝐒 𝐂𝐎𝐌𝐌𝐔𝐍𝐈𝐓𝐘 𝐒𝐄𝐑𝐕𝐈𝐂𝐄 𝐓𝐎 𝐒𝐔𝐏𝐏𝐎𝐑𝐓 𝐂𝐇𝐔𝐑𝐂𝐇 𝐂𝐎𝐍𝐒𝐓𝐑𝐔𝐂𝐓𝐈𝐎𝐍

𝑩𝒓𝒈𝒚. 𝑷𝒊𝒍𝒊, 𝑴𝒂𝒍𝒊𝒎𝒐𝒏𝒐, 𝑺𝒖𝒓𝒊𝒈𝒂𝒐 𝒅𝒆𝒍 𝑵𝒐𝒓𝒕𝒆 — The Golden Surigao 𝓔𝓪𝓰𝓵𝓮𝓼 Club (GSEC) successfully carried out a community service initiative on Sunday morning, donating construction materials to the Iglesia Filipina Independiente (IFI) Pili Parish Church.

Held at the central church grounds, the outreach was graced by the presence of Revd Donard Paculi, parish rector, and members of the congregation, alongside officers and members of GSEC.

This act of service was in line with GSEC’s commitment to civic responsibility and spiritual solidarity, strengthening the bond between the organization and local faith-based communities. The initiative was made possible through the generous support of 𝓔𝓪𝓰𝓵𝓮 Wilven Masalta and family, who are also active members of the said church.

“This effort embodies our club’s mission—to serve and uplift communities through meaningful action. The donated materials will aid the ongoing improvement of the church building, ensuring a more conducive place of worship for the faithful in the parish," Kuya Wil said.

The community service is part of GSEC’s broader mission of fostering compassion, unity, and empowerment among its members and the communities they serve. #
